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 78°F (25°C) | 6.8 in | Wettest |
| February | 78°F (25°C) | 5.9 in | |
| March | 78°F (25°C) | 5.8 in | |
| April | 78°F (25°C) | 3.8 in | |
| May | 77°F (25°C) | 0.6 in | |
| June | 75°F (24°C) | 0.1 in | |
| July | 75°F (24°C) | 0.0 in | Coldest, Driest |
| August | 77°F (25°C) | 0.1 in | |
| September | 80°F (27°C) | 0.4 in | |
| October | 81°F (27°C) | 2.3 in | Warmest |
| November | 79°F (26°C) | 5.4 in | |
| December | 78°F (26°C) | 6.0 in |
Curimatá has a seasonal temperature swing of 6°F / from 75°F in July to 81°F in October. Total annual precipitation is 37.1 inches, with January being the wettest month (6.8") and July the driest (0.0").
